[部署]CentOS安装PHP环境
2015-09-09 11:34
495 查看
环境
虚拟机:VMWare10.0.1 build-1379776操作系统:CentOS7 64位
HTTP Server:Apache(httpd)
步骤
PHP环境需要HTTP服务器支持,本文使用的HTTP服务器为Apache,您也可以选用现在比较流行的Nginx。Apache默认根目录查看位置/etc/httpd/conf/httpd.conf文件中查看DocumentRoot配置值
1、安装php
yum install php php-devel
2、安装php常用扩展(可选,根据自己实际需求)
yum install php-mysql php-gd php-imap php-ldap php-odbc php-pear php-xml php-xmlrpc
3、重启apache使php生效
apachectl restart
4、测试php环境
在/var/www/html目录(Apache默认根目录)中新建info.php
vi /var/www/html/info.php
文件内容
<?php phpinfo(); ?>
访问http://localhost/info.php
附加:mysql测试
在/var/www/html目录(apache默认根目录)中新建mysql.php
vi /var/www/htmml/mysql.php
文件内容
<?php $con = mysql_connect("localhost","root","root"); if (!$con) { die('Could not connect: ' . mysql_error()); } mysql_select_db("mysql", $con); $result = mysql_query("SELECT * FROM user"); while($row = mysql_fetch_array($result)) { echo $row['User'] . " " . $row['Host']; echo "<br />"; } mysql_close($con); ?>
访问http://localhost/mysql.php
相关文章推荐
- linux 常用命令详解
- Linux进程理解与实践(二)僵尸&孤儿进程 和文件共享
- linux 系统监控命令 vmstat
- centos7 PHP5.6.13升级
- Linux进程理解与实践(一)基本概念和编程概述(fork,vfork,cow)
- linux 系统监控命令 vmstat
- SELinux 基础
- LINUX系统安全_SANDBOX
- 兼容Windows 和 Linux 的文件读写工具类
- Linux应用程序应该存放在什么位置
- linux终端python自动提示
- 初窥Linux 之 ext2/ext3文件系统
- kickstart安装linux
- epoll LT和ET区别
- linux device name
- 【未完】history查看历史命令记录及时间
- 【未完】Linux下supervisor监控应用的安装和配置
- 【未完】Linux下创建和删除软、硬链接
- linux体系结构与内核结构
- some linux commands